I finally got my computer back up and running today after 3 weeks of inoperation. I had to have the CPU, mobo, and my GTX all replaced via RMA. Everything seems to be working fine now except it's not displaying any red colors for some reason. Normally a graphics card displays 3 colors: red, green, and blue, which can mix and become other colors as you probably know. But for some reason, it's almost as if this graphics card can only display green and blue because that's all that's showing up on my monitor.

I've tried 2 different monitors with the same results, reinstalled the drivers, I even double checked and triple checked to make sure the cable wasn't plugged in incorrectly or something. Any ideas?

I don't want to RMA again so if I can't get this fixed then I guess I'll just have to deal with it until I can afford to upgrade my graphics card.
 
Are you using a DVI -> VGA adapter? Sometimes that can screw the connection up. If you have another cable lying around try that as well. It could just be the actual wiring inside the cable that isn't working.

Also make sure the cable isn't near anything magnetic. That can distort the colours.
 
Yes I am using an DVI-VGA adapter... the gtx only has dvi out connections and my monitor needs vga so I don't have a choice unfortunately... thanks for the suggestions, I'll try different adapters and things like that when I get home.
